Effective Methods to Boost Cellular Wi-Fi Router Speed

In today's increasingly prevalent Industrial Internet of Things (IIoT) era, cellular Wi-Fi routers serve as the core devices bridging the physical and digital worlds. Their performance and stability directly impact the efficiency and security of the entire production process. This article, from a professional perspective, delves into several effective methods to enhance the speed of cellular Wi-Fi routers, empowering traditional industries to better adapt to the demands of digital transformation.

I. Selecting the Right Cellular Wi-Fi Router

The foundation for improving network speed lies in choosing the appropriate cellular Wi-Fi router. Unlike household routers, industrial-grade ones require higher performance, greater stability, and broader adaptability. Key factors to consider when selecting include:

  1. High-Performance Hardware: Opt for routers equipped with high-performance processors and large memory capacities to support high-speed data processing and numerous concurrent connections.

  2. Dual-Band Support: Prefer routers that support both 2.4GHz and 5GHz bands, leveraging the high-bandwidth characteristics of the 5GHz band to elevate data transmission speeds.

  3. Specialized Protocols and Standards: Select routers compatible with industrial communication protocols like Modbus, OPC UA, MQTT, tailored to the specific needs of industrial applications, ensuring data accuracy and reliability.

II. Optimizing the Network Environment

The network environment is a crucial factor influencing cellular Wi-Fi router speed. By optimizing it, you can significantly enhance data transmission speed and stability:

  1. Strategic Placement: Locate the router centrally within the application environment to ensure even signal coverage. Avoid metallic enclosures or proximity to walls to minimize signal attenuation.

  2. Interference Reduction: Regularly inspect and eliminate sources of electromagnetic interference, such as microwaves and cordless phones, to reduce WiFi signal interference.

  3. Peak Hour Management: Schedule data transmission tasks to avoid peak hours, minimizing network congestion.

IV. Hardware Acceleration and Software Optimization

These are vital tools for boosting cellular Wi-Fi router speed:

  1. Firmware Updates: Regularly update router firmware and drivers to access the latest features and performance enhancements.

  2. Specialized Software Tools: Utilize dedicated traffic control and router management software for real-time monitoring and management, optimizing network traffic allocation and accelerating data transfer.

  3. Multi-Path Transmission: Employ multi-path transmission technology to distribute data across multiple network paths, enhancing reliability and stability.

VI. Regular Maintenance and Inspections

Lastly, maintaining and inspecting the cellular Wi-Fi router regularly is crucial for sustained high-speed operation. This includes dust cleaning, antenna connection checks, signal strength tests, and regular performance evaluations and security audits to identify and address potential issues promptly.
